Reassessment Of The 1930s Chinese Movie

Chinese cinema came to a critical period of its development in the 1930s when the Japanese imperialism fastened its aggression against China and nationalism of Chinese people was reaching an unprecedented point. Thus cinema was required to meet the new historical demands. Just then, the underground intellectuals led by CPC set up a film group and launched a New Film Movement(xin xing dian ying yun dong). They brought Marxism into filmmaking and film reviews and fought with the official ideology of KMT. In the result, they created a road of realism for Chinese film and achieved tremendously in film production. Led by the progressive left-wing filmmakers, Chinese film experienced many radical changes. It was also in the 1930s that Chinese film turned from silent movie to talkies. The silent movie reached its peak level and at the same time talkies matured itself rapidly with the efforts of those progressive filmmakers. With the ideology dispute as its focus, Chinese film was under the influence of other social-cultural backgrounds as well.Many important film artists appeared in the 1930. Film artists like Xia Yan, Tian Han, Yang Hansheng and Hong Shen made decisive contributions to screenplay writing. Two generations of film artists like Zheng Zhengqiu, Sun Yu, Cai Chusheng, Shen Xiling and Wu Yonggang presented many movies which are socially progressive and artistically refined. They gained very high artistic achievements and their movies had distinctive characteristics.Film critics and theory in this period of time should also be paid attention to. The left-wing film theorists accepted the Soviet proletariat film theory and introduced European film theories to China as well. At the same time, Hollywood movie continued to exert great influence on Chinese filmmaking and theory. The progressive film theory perfected itself in its debates with KMT official film theory on the one hand and the so-called "soft movie" theory on the other.The New Film had to survive the privately owned film production system then. Therefore, it had to meet the demands of commercial consideration of filmmaking. The running method and strategy of private film studios offered important historical experiences. Following the way of commercial film production, the New Film efficiently "infiltrate" its ideology and influenced the filmmakers and audience greatly. These movies were marketed excellently and at the same kept its ideological characteristics. Welcomed by audience, these movies shows that they stood in the forefront of the time.
